Stretch marks, also known as striae, are scars that occur when the skin stretches rapidly due to factors such as pregnancy, rapid weight gain or loss, and hormonal changes. They often appear as pink or purple lines on the skin and can be found on various parts of the body, including the abdomen, breasts, hips, and thighs. Despite their commonality, the perception of stretch marks can vary greatly among individuals.
